Zauba

QUICK%20CARGO%20CRAFT%20TECHNOLOGIES%20PRIVATE%20LIMITEDCIN: U62090DL2025PTC440812
new.inc
QUICK CARGO CRAFT TECHNOLOGIES PRIVATE LIMITED | Zauba